How to prepare for a job interview at Resource on Demand
β¨Know Your Salesforce Inside Out
Make sure youβre well-versed in Salesforce Financial Services Cloud. Brush up on the latest features and functionalities, and be ready to discuss how you've implemented them in past projects. This will show your expertise and passion for the platform.
β¨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Prepare to discuss specific challenges you've faced in previous roles and how you overcame them using Salesforce solutions.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and highlight your critical thinking abilities.
β¨Understand the Financial Services Sector
Familiarise yourself with the current trends and challenges in the financial services industry. Be prepared to discuss how Salesforce can address these issues and improve client outcomes. This will demonstrate your industry knowledge and strategic thinking.
